Summary

Timothy Daaleman is a family medicine specialist with 35 years of experience providing comprehensive healthcare to patients and families. He earned his medical degree from Kansas City University of Medicine & Bioscience College of Osteopathic Medicine, building a strong foundation in osteopathic principles that emphasize treating the whole person. Daaleman speaks English and has dedicated more than three decades to caring for patients across all stages of life.

Daaleman practices at Duke Regional Hospital and serves patients in Chapel Hill, North Carolina. He specializes in managing type 2 diabetes and treating joint pain conditions. His approach includes physical therapy and strength training to help patients improve their mobility and overall health.
